go to a local fabric store..... ask for fake animal print fur or whatever you want...If you want to keep your fairings nice under the fabric i would not use automotive adheasive but use a hot glue gun and just glue the edges and stretch it over the fairing accourdingly... it takes a little bit longer but it turns out better and does not take forever to take off if you want to change it.
